What is a mainframe developer with COBOL?

Mainframe Developers with COBOL are IT professionals who specialize in developing, maintaining, and supporting applications that run on mainframe computers using the COBOL programming language. They work with legacy systems, often in industries like banking, insurance, or government, where mainframes are still prevalent due to their reliability and processing power. Their responsibilities include coding, debugging, testing, and optimizing COBOL programs, as well as integrating mainframe applications with newer technologies. Mainframe Developers also ensure the performance and security of mission-critical systems that handle large volumes of data.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a mainframe developer with COBOL?

To thrive as a Mainframe Developer with COBOL, you need expertise in COBOL programming, mainframe systems (such as IBM z/OS), JCL, and database management, typically supported by a degree in computer science or a related field. Familiarity with tools like TSO/ISPF, DB2, CICS, and source control systems is commonly required, and certifications in mainframe technologies can be advantageous. Strong problem-solving, attention to detail, and effective communication skills help you manage complex legacy systems and collaborate with cross-functional teams. These skills and qualifications are vital for maintaining, enhancing, and supporting critical business applications that rely on mainframe environments.

What are some common challenges faced by mainframe developers working with COBOL, and how can they be overcome?

Mainframe Developers working with COBOL often encounter challenges such as maintaining legacy code, integrating mainframe systems with modern technologies, and adapting to evolving business requirements. Legacy systems may lack proper documentation, making it crucial to develop strong debugging and reverse-engineering skills. Collaborating closely with business analysts and other IT teams helps ensure a clear understanding of requirements and smoother integration projects. Staying up-to-date with mainframe modernization tools and participating in knowledge-sharing sessions within your team can also help overcome these challenges and support career growth.
